The numbers hit my screen like a jolt of static electricity. 659%. That's the spike in XRP Ledger's active addresses over the past week. In my years of dissecting on-chain data, such a parabolic jump in network participation is rarely organic. It's a heartbeat, yes, but whose heartbeat? Excavating truth from the code's buried layers, I see a story that the headline numbers don't tell. This isn't a technical breakthrough; it's a market phenomenon wearing the clothes of network growth. Let's set the stage. XRP Ledger isn't your typical smart-contract platform. It's a non-EVM, federated consensus network that has been humming along for over a decade. Its architecture, relying on a Unique Node List (UNL) rather than a permissionless validator set, allows for high throughput and negligible fees. This design makes it a specialized settlement layer, not a general-purpose compute engine. The recent price action, holding steady around $1.5, and this surge in activity, are intertwined. But correlation here is not causation; it's a reflection of market sentiment and external narratives like the ETF speculation and the tailwind of regulatory clarity following the SEC lawsuit. Now, for the core analysis. The critical question isn't 'why did addresses spike?' but 'what kind of addresses are these?' From my experience auditing protocol data, a 659% increase in active addresses without a corresponding explosion in unique new wallets often points to a few specific drivers. It could be exchange wallet consolidation, where a single entity moves funds across thousands of internal addresses. It could be automated market-making bots executing high-frequency trades, which are cheap on XRP Ledger. Or, it could be a specific institutional payment corridor lighting up. The data is a Rorschach test; the interpretation depends on the underlying transaction patterns. If we see a surge in transaction volume and a high ratio of new addresses, that's a bullish signal of genuine adoption. If we see a spike in zero-value or dust transactions, we're likely looking at noise. This leads me to the contrarian angle. The market is treating this address surge as a confirmation of XRP's resurgence. But I see a potential blind spot: the centralization of the validator set. The UNL model, while efficient, creates a trust assumption that is fundamentally different from Ethereum's PoS. In a bear market, where survival is the priority, this architectural dependency is a latent risk. If a significant portion of the UNL were to be compromised or coerced, the network's integrity would be questioned. The surge in activity doesn't mitigate this; it amplifies the potential impact of a failure. Every bug is a story waiting to be decoded, and the story here is that the network's performance is a feature, but its governance is a liability. The price holding at $1.5 is a market verdict, but it's a verdict on narrative, not on the resilience of the consensus mechanism. So, what's the takeaway? This address spike is a lagging indicator, a confirmation of price momentum, not a leading signal of fundamental growth. The real test will be whether this activity translates into sustained, organic usage. I'm watching the transaction volume-to-address ratio and the percentage of new addresses over the next few weeks. If those metrics don't hold, this surge will be remembered as a footnote in a speculative cycle.
